| Power supply range | 12VDC – 24VDC |
| Output method | 0 – 10V |
| Operating temperature | -25℃ – 60℃ |
| Response spectrum | 400nm – 700nm |
| Measuring range | 0 – 2500μmol/㎡·s |

1. Can this sensor be used for both sunlight and LED grow lights?
Yes, the New Quantum (PAR) Light Sensor is designed to measure both natural sunlight and artificial LED grow lights with high accuracy.
2. What is the spectral range the quantum (PAR) light sensor can measure?
It measures the full PAR spectrum (400 –700 nm), which is ideal for plant photosynthesis monitoring.
3. Is the 0–10 V analog output compatible with all major greenhouse control systems or only specific ones?
The 0–10 V output is a standard signal, making it compatible with most major greenhouse controllers, including Link4 systems.
4. What does the sensor include?
The New Quantum (PAR) Light Sensor comes with a level and adjustment handwheel, a 20ft cable, and an aluminum housing.
